To create a triangle, the sum of the two shorter sides must be greater than the third side.
If the side of length 14 is the longest side then the missing side must be greater than 14 - 10 = 4
If the missing side is the longest side then the missing side must be less than 10 + 14 = 24
Thus any length that is greater than 4 and less than 24.
Examples include: 16, 5, 8, 10.

The three sides could all be a million miles long, or they could be microscopic, but if they are all the same length, then the triangle is equilateral.It would be better to ask about classifying triangles by the relative lengths of their sides.If all the sides are different lengths, we class it as a Scalene Triangle. (Note that all three angles also are different.)If exactly two sides have the same length we call it an Isosceles triangle (Note that two of the angles also are the same size. And try to get the spelling right!!!)If all three sides are the same length, we call it an Equilateral triangle. (If you like you could say that it is a special case of an isosceles triangle). All three angle are the same and they always are sixty degrees each.

Triangle inequality says that the sum of the lengths of any two sides of a triangle is greater than the length of the third side.Since 15 + 5 = 20 < 25, we cannot draw a triangle.
